This year City & Guilds celebrates 10 years of the Princess Royal Training Awards. The Princess Royal Training Awards were created in 2016 to recognise and reward organisations demonstrating exceptional best practice in workplace training and skills development.

Digital learning provider Omniplex Learning has increased revenue by 18% and EBITDA by 25% year-on-year following investment in its people, systems and infrastructure. The business expects revenue and EBITDA to further grow by 20% and 25% respectively this year, supported by strong demand for AI-enabled products.

The market for corporate training has reached almost four hundred billion USD globally, growing at 3.45% annually over the last three years - Training Industry annual report.
